Kano Court Sentences Two to Death for Groom's Murder
On October 2025, a Kano State High Court sentenced two men, Aliyu Hussaini and Amir Zakariyya, to death by hanging for the murder of a newly married man, Yazid Haruna, during a robbery. Justice Amina Adamu ruled that the prosecution proved its case beyond a reasonable doubt, describing the attack as brutal and disturbing.
The incident occurred at 2:47 AM on June 11, 2025, in Sheka Sabuwar Abuja Quarter, where the defendants reportedly armed themselves with long knives and machetes to attack the victim. They robbed him of two mobile phones and 19,500 Naira, subsequently stabbing him multiple times, leading to his death from the injuries.
Although the defendants denied the charges and pleaded for leniency, they were convicted under sections 97(1), 298(c), and 221 of the Kano State Penal Code, receiving sentences of death for culpable homicide and life imprisonment for armed robbery.
